State Rep. Jim Jacks said today he has resigned, effective immediately.
The 49th District Democrat, who was first elected in 2008, said he was leaving office for personal reasons, which he did not want publicly stated.
Jacks, 41, was re-elected in November.
The county commissioners will appoint a replacement from a list of three nominations culled by the Clark County Democratic precinct leaders.
The replacement will have to run in November to keep the seat.
